Dipole oscillator strengths for excitation, ionisation and fragmentation of NH3 in the 5 to 60 eV region

Dipole oscillator strengths for absorption parent-ion formation and fragmention formation of NH3 have been obtained, using techniques of energy-loss electron spectroscopy and electron-ion coincidence. The data have been analysed using branching ratios for the three electronic states of NH3+ which have been derived from a recent electron-electron coincidence experiment. The given fragmentation patterns for the three ionic states were found to give a reasonable fit to the data. Discrete excited states converging on both the 1e and 2a1 ionic limits were found to give rise to some neutral formation.
